Subterranean termite Coptotermes spp. has been known as the most economically important structural pest in Indonesia. Due to morphological ambiguity, traditional identification of Coptotermes spp. has always been difficult and unreliable. Through molecular diagnostic method, a study was conducted to determine genetic variation of Coptotermes spp. occurring in Java Island. Termite specimens were collected from Banten 1, Banten 2, DKI 1, DKI 2, Jabar 1, Jabar 2, Jateng 1, Jateng 2, Yogya 1, Yogya 2, Jatim 1, and Jatim 2. The method for identification was PCR-Restriction Fragment Length Polymorphism (PCR-RFLP) analysis using four restriction enzymes each of which was applied to CO II amplicon for all the Coptotermes spp. being analyzed. The results showed the existence of two species of Coptotermes in Java which are different from both Coptotermes gestroi and Coptotermes formosanus.
